小学生也能开发的安卓APP教程

需积分: 0 1 下载量 173 浏览量 更新于2024-10-14 收藏 3.32MB ZIP 举报
资源摘要信息:"深海王国小学生都能做的APP?最终成品APP,安卓安卓包" 从标题中我们可以得知,这款APP被设计成适合小学生操作和理解的难度,即使是没有太多编程背景的小学生也可以通过某种工具或平台完成它的制作。而描述中的提示“请参考系列文章——【深海王国】小学生都能做的APP?”暗示了这可能是一个教程系列,或者是有配套的文档和指南,用以引导用户学习如何一步步地制作这个APP。同时,标签“android APP开发 APPINVENTOR”则透露出开发这个APP所使用的工具和环境。 接下来,我们结合上述信息详细说明知识点: 1. Android APP开发基础: - Android是一个基于Linux内核的开源操作系统,主要设计用于触摸屏移动设备,如智能手机和平板电脑。Android应用通常使用Java编程语言开发。 - Android应用的结构通常包括多个组件,如Activity(活动)、Service(服务)、BroadcastReceiver(广播接收器)和ContentProvider(内容提供者)。 - 开发Android应用需要Android SDK(软件开发工具包),它提供了各种库、开发工具和调试工具。 2. APPINVENTOR平台: - APPINVENTOR是一种面向初学者的可视化编程环境,可以让用户通过拖放的方式来创建移动应用。 - APPINVENTOR特别适合没有编程经验的用户,因为它通过图形化的界面消除了传统编程语言的复杂性。 - 使用APPINVENTOR时,用户不需要编写代码,只需选择预定义的组件并将它们组合在一起,设置属性和逻辑,即可创建应用。 - 对于小学生来说,APPINVENTOR可以作为一个很好的起点来了解编程的基本概念和逻辑思维。 3. 教学内容与系列文章: - 从标题和描述来看,很可能存在一系列的教程文章或教学视频,指导用户如何一步步构建这款名为“深海王国”的APP。 - 教程可能涵盖了从简单的界面设计到更复杂的功能实现,比如如何使用APPINVENTOR的组件来实现特定的游戏逻辑或用户界面。 - 教程可能还包括一些基础的编程概念,如变量、循环、条件判断等,这些都是编程中常见且重要的概念。 4. 安卓安装包: - 最终的成品是一个安卓安装包(APK文件),这意味着用户可以通过这个APK文件在安卓设备上安装和运行APP。 - APK文件是安卓应用程序的压缩包格式,它包含了应用的所有代码、资源、资产、证书等。 - 安装APK文件到安卓设备需要确保设备的“未知来源”安装选项被启用,这是因为出于安全考虑,安卓系统默认不允许安装非官方市场的应用。 5. 教育意义与适用性: - 小学生能制作APP的项目对于提高他们的信息技术技能和兴趣有显著帮助,特别是在编程教育和STEAM(科学、技术、工程、艺术和数学)教育领域。 - 这类项目有助于培养学生解决问题的能力、创造性思维和逻辑推理能力。 总结来说,这款APP的开发涉及到了Android平台的APP开发基础、使用APPINVENTOR这样的简单编程环境、通过系列教程学习编程逻辑,以及如何将最终的APP打包和分发。这对于小学生来说是一个非常好的学习工具,让他们在寓教于乐的环境中接触并初步了解编程世界。